https://9to5mac.com/guides/spotify/" target="_blank" rel="noreferrer noopener">Spotify[/url] achieved its first full year of profitability since launching in 2008. The company has previously had occasional profitable quarters, but consistently lost money each year.</p>
<p><a href="
https://9to5mac.com/guides/aapl/" target="_blank" rel="noreferrer noopener">Apple[/url] may have played a role in the company’s turnaround, thanks to a change introduced last year …</p>
